Transaction 93b507538019b2c3a1742e28c120b46a609bd73a30be3496499e5116b59c4f56
1 Input
2 Outputs
- 93b507538019b2c3a1742e28c120b46a609bd73a30be3496499e5116b59c4f56:0
- 93b507538019b2c3a1742e28c120b46a609bd73a30be3496499e5116b59c4f56:1
value 1080000
address 1dice9wcMu5hLF4g81u8nioL5mmSHTApw
value 354570
address 1MxZc7suycmacAgUwyyoBZ4ZRGH7RmaVhV